The State Treasury’s office building on Sörnäisten rantatie in Helsinki has been too large for the occupant’s needs in recent years. After conducting several studies, Senate Properties – the owner of the building – proposed a solution where the State Treasury will be located in its current office building together with the Finnish Patent and Registration Office, and the premises will be altered to create multispace offices in line with the state strategy on offices. Interior design workshops were held to identify the special requirements of both occupants, taking into account a consistent interior design and space arrangements throughout the building. The design for the premises in joint use was prepared at collaborative meetings with both organisations, and the personnel were included when all of the materials and furniture were selected. The perspectives of the personnel were taken into consideration in the design choices.
